Gray Hawk (1)

But God demonstrates His own love toward us, in that while we were still sinners, Christ died for us.
Romans 5:8

Gray Hawk (1)
Gray Hawk was an American Indian. But he was also a liar, a cheat and a murderer. The white men had put a bounty on his head but he always managed to escape them. When he heard that missionaries were setting out to visit a friendly Indian tribe, he decided to join their trek incognito.

He hated the Christians, he hated their songs and their church services, but most of all he hated the little black book they always read from. But now he was travelling with them, for weeks on end. On Sundays, when the party rested, he grabbed his rifle and went hunting all day. He didn’t want to hear any sermons or songs.

July arrived, and it became oppressively hot. Although it was Sunday, Gray Hawk, for the first time ever, didn’t feel like going hunting. He stretched out in the shade of a covered wagon and fell asleep. When he awoke, there was singing all around him. This was because the missionaries had just gathered around his covered wagon for their church service. He was too tired to move and so he remained lying there, seemingly unaffected and uninterested.

The missionary who was preaching presented the love of God that had given people everything they needed. He explained that people hated God and rejected Him. But God loved His creatures and sent to earth His Son, Jesus Christ, who died so that people could be saved and go to heaven. Gray Hawk listened even though he didn’t want to, even though he rejected God and hated the Bible.

Perhaps someone is ‘listening’ right now, who actually doesn’t want to listen but needs to hear that God loves him and wants to reach his heart.
